ACCOUNTING MANAGER
Location: Rockwall, TX – 100% Onsite
Employment Type: Direct Hire | Full-Time
Salary: $80,000–$90,000 DOE
Imprimis Group has partnered with an amazing nonprofit organization in Rockwall, TX that is seeking an experienced, hands-on Accounting Manager to oversee day-to-day accounting operations, financial reporting and nonprofit compliance.
This is an excellent opportunity for a strong Senior Accountant or Accounting Manager with nonprofit experience who is ready to take greater ownership of the accounting function. The organization offers a stable financial environment, direct exposure to executive leadership and the Board, and long-term professional growth.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Manage month-end close and prepare accurate monthly, quarterly and annual financial statements.
- Manage general ledger activity, reconciliations, accounts payable, accounts receivable and cash flow.
- Support annual organizational and program budgets.
- Coordinate the annual audit process and work with external auditors and accounting resources.
- Maintain accurate financial records and ensure compliance with GAAP and applicable nonprofit accounting requirements.
- Maintain nonprofit financial documentation and support required regulatory and tax filings, including Form 990.
- Prepare financial reports and supporting materials for leadership and Board review.
- Communicate financial results and relevant information to executive leadership and Board representatives.
- Oversee payroll administration and ensure timely and accurate processing.
- Maintain and improve accounting processes, policies and internal controls.
- Identify opportunities to streamline and automate accounting processes.
- Support grant budgeting, financial reporting and other finance-related development activities.
- Coordinate insurance administration and related financial documentation.
- Handle confidential financial, employee and organizational information with discretion.
QUALIFICATIONS:
- Approximately 4–7 years of progressive accounting experience required.
- Nonprofit accounting experience strongly required.
- Experience with month-end close, financial statements, budgeting and audit support.
- Working knowledge of nonprofit accounting practices, including restricted funds and Form 990 requirements.
- Experience communicating financial information to leadership and/or Board members.
- QuickBooks experience required; QuickBooks Online required, or similar.
- Payroll/HRIS experience; ADP Workforce Now experience is a plus.
- Strong Microsoft Office skills including advanced Excel.
-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ance or related field preferred; relevant experience will also be considered.
- Strong attention to detail with the ability to independently manage deadlines and priorities.
- Professional written and verbal communication skills.
- Successful completion required background screening.
